Cost of making a brand new car key

You may be wondering much it will cost to replace your car keys in case you're locked out of your car. There are a variety of places that will provide you with keys. Some of these are auto dealers who can provide replacement keys for independent repair shops. While the auto locksmith near me could be less expensive than your local dealer, the cost may still be expensive.

First, you must determine the type of key you need. For older cars keys that are standard may be sufficient. For programming the key fob, a specific key is needed for those who own newer cars. If you're locked out of your car, a professional locksmith near you will be able to create a brand new key for you at only a fraction of the cost.

Keys today have numerous characteristics that make them difficult to duplicate. This makes it harder for thieves to steal cars from car owners. There are more keys that are able to be used as a separate piece. Many keys can be connected to specific vehicles using transponder chips. The type of car key you require will be based on the year, make and model of your car. Costs for duplicate keys will be greater for keys that are more complex.

It is recommended to have a few spare keys in case you require them. This might not be an option if you only have one key that functions. A nearby auto locksmith will charge between $7 and the 125th of a duplicate key, depending on the type and programming of the blank key. In addition, the cost of programming an FOB can vary wildly.

A regular car key can be made anywhere from $4 to $10, whereas the cost of a transponder key is anywhere from $100 to $400. A transponder key will stop the car alarm from ringing when it is stolen. And depending on your car the process of programming a transponder key could cost between $50-$200, based on its model and type. In certain instances, it is possible to switch your vehicle's mechanical lock to an electronic one, which can cost anywhere between $100 and $300.

Cost of getting the transponder key from a dealership

The cost of replacing a transponder fob varies from $15 to $200, based on the model and make of the car. For just $50, you could have your transponder keys replaced at an auto dealer. Or, for $100-200 locksmiths can program it for you. The majority of transponder keys have a chip inside that communicates with the car. Without the chip your car won't start.

The cost of programming a transponder key in the dealership is contingent upon several factors, including the make and model of the vehicle. For instance, a recent model Ford F-150 will require a $150 transponder key and an $75 fob. If you don't need an electronic transmitter, a standard key without a transmitter may be programmed for $50-$75. This is a viable option for those who frequently leave their keys in your car.

Before you purchase the transponder key, be sure you check the immobilizer codes. The majority of cars built after 1997 come with an immobilizer. The transponder within the key head responds to a roll-code that is sent by the immobilizer. Without the immobilizer code, your car will not start. The good news is that locksmiths can duplicate transponder keys for an affordable price.
